PB 3des加密
时间: 2024-05-18 16:10:10 浏览: 14
PB 3DES加密是一种常用的对称加密算法,其全称是“Password-Based Triple DES Encryption”,意为基于口令的三重数据加密标准。它是将3DES算法与口令加密相结合的一种加密方式,可以通过用户提供的密码将明文加密成密文,并且只有拥有相应密码的用户才能解密出明文。
具体来说,PB 3DES加密算法使用用户提供的口令(password)和一个随机生成的salt(盐值)来生成密钥。其中salt是一个随机数,旨在增加破解密码的难度。生成密钥后,使用3DES算法对明文进行加密,生成密文。解密时,需要使用同样的口令和salt生成密钥,然后对密文进行解密,得到原始明文。
相关问题
pb base64加密
pb base64是一种基于pb格式的加密方式,也称为protobuf base64。pb是Protocol Buffers的简称,是一种轻量级的数据序列化方案,用于在不同应用之间传输和存储结构化数据。而base64是一种编码方式,可以将二进制数据转换为可打印的ASCII字符。
使用pb base64加密时,首先需要将数据按照pb格式进行编码,将其转换为一种统一的数据结构。然后,将这个编码后的数据进行base64编码,将二进制数据转换为一串可打印的ASCII字符。这样做的目的是方便数据传输和存储,因为pb base64编码后的数据大小会变得更小。
在解密时,需要先对base64编码的数据进行解码,将其转换为二进制形式。然后,再将解码后的数据按照pb格式进行解析,恢复原始的数据结构。
pb base64加密在很多场景下都有广泛的应用,比如网络传输、数据存储等。它可以有效地减小数据的体积,提高传输效率和存储空间的利用率。同时,由于base64编码后的数据只包含ASCII字符,因此在不支持二进制传输的场景下也可以正常传输。
需要注意的是,pb base64加密并不是一种加密算法,它只是提供了一种编码方式,可以保护数据的完整性和可读性。对于数据安全性要求较高的场景,还需要额外的加密措施,比如加密算法和密钥管理等。
pb3d003m200
pb3d003m200是一个产品型号或编码,根据这个编码我们无法得知具体的产品信息。一般来说,一个产品的型号或编码可以提供给客户或供应商以便于溯源、查询和管理。将产品标识为唯一编码有助于区分不同的产品型号,从而方便组织进行生产、销售和售后服务。如果您需要了解更多关于pb3d003m200的信息,建议您联系相关的制造商、供应商或销售商进行咨询。